The Caregiver form sample with questions in Wake is designed to establish a formal agreement between a caregiver and a client, outlining the terms of service and responsibilities. This form includes essential sections detailing the obligations of the caregiver, including assistance with daily living activities, medication management, and mobility support. Notably, it emphasizes the importance of a mutually agreed schedule, which can only be altered with sufficient notice. The form also addresses termination rights, allowing either party to end the agreement with two weeks' notice. Legal clauses encompass the governing law, acknowledgment of independent contractor status, and provisions for handling breaches, including attorney fees. What to Include in a Checklist for Caregivers Name of caregiver on duty. Date the checklist is being used. Name of patients. Patient's morning, afternoon, and evening routines, such as: Taking medication and vital signs. Eating food and drinking water. Housekeeping tasks to do. Changes in patient's condition, if any.

Nursing care notes should include observations of the patient's physical and emotional condition, details of any treatments or medications given, responses to treatment, and any changes in the care plan.

How do I write a Carer / Impact Statement? their disability and how it impacts their day to day functioning. what they need support with, and what their carer does to support them. your own needs and goals as a carer, and how the caring role affects you. whether you can keep caring for them in the same way into the future.
